OverviewIn this book readers will discover a wide range of men and women who have had dramatic effects upon the history of the world including: military (Attila the Hun and Genghis Khan); monarchs (Elizabeth I and Louis XVI); dictators (Joseph Stalin and Nikita Khrushchev); religious (Pope John XXIII and Siddhartha Gautama); U.S. Presidents (George Washington and Franklin D. Roosevelt); and much more! Table of ContentsReviewsAuthor InformationKathy Paparchontis is a California-based editor and writer. She is the co-author of Sacramento Women Past and Present. She is also the editor of The Golden Notes a publication of the Sacramento County Historical Society and operates an editorial services company with her husband.
